The E series International Match value is due to its value to collectors. I doubt you will see many in use in competition on a National level. I still use one in club matches, and for the most part they are very accurate. They were built to higher standard than the factory production 52’s. The IM’s were built in the custom shop at Winchester and had to pass a stringent accuracy requirement with both Winchester Super Match and Eley Tenex ammunition. They are not all that rare, with over 450 built. They were offered with 3 trigger options, the factory Winchester Micro Motion, Kenyon and ISU Kenyon. The regular Kenyon trigger was the most popular of the 3 choices.
